#53dbf5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53dbf5 is composed of 32.5% red, 85.9%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 10.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 189.6 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 64.3%. #53dbf5 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#00b7eb.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#53dbf5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53dbf5 has RGB values of R:83, G:219,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5495797.

Shades and Tints of #53dbf5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b0d is the darkest color, while #fafe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#53dbf5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a7a8 is the less saturated color, while #4ce0fc is the most saturated one.
